A Brief History of Robot Vacuums
The idea of automated cleaning devices goes back to the early 20th century, however it wasn't until the late 1990s that the first commercially effective robot hoover and mop vacuum was presented. The iRobot Roomba, launched in 2002, was a game-changer. At first, these gadgets were standard, relying on random navigation and minimal sensing units. However, for many years, advancements in robotics, synthetic intelligence, and machine knowing have caused more advanced designs that can browse intricate environments, avoid obstacles, and tidy more effectively.
How Robot Vacuums Work
Robot vacuums operate using a mix of sensors, algorithms, and motors. Here's a breakdown of the essential elements:

Navigation Systems:
** RANDOM NAVIGATION: ** Early designs used random navigation, moving in no particular pattern to cover the floor.** MAPPING TECHNOLOGY: ** Modern robot vacuums use innovative mapping innovation, such as LIDAR (Light Detection and Ranging) and VSLAM (Visual Simultaneous Localization and Mapping), to produce a map of the space and browse effectively.** SENSORS: ** Various sensors, consisting of infrared, ultrasonic, and cliff sensing units, help the robot hoover uk find obstacles and prevent falls.
** Cleaning Mechanisms: **
** BRUSHES: ** Most robot vacuums have a combination of brushes, including side brushes and primary brushes, to sweep and collect dirt.** SUCTION: ** The suction power varies amongst designs, with higher-end systems offering more effective suction to deal with a variety of cleaning needs.** FILTERS: ** HEPA filters are commonly used to trap irritants and fine particles, making robot vacuums beneficial for people with allergies.
